diff --git a/test/bats/01_cscli.bats b/test/bats/01_cscli.bats index dd03ea207..3a5b4aad0 100644 --- a/test/bats/01_cscli.bats +++ b/test/bats/01_cscli.bats @@ -115,15 +115,18 @@ teardown() { assert_output "&false" # complex type - rune -0 cscli config show --key Config.PluginConfig + rune -0 cscli config show --key Config.Prometheus assert_output - <<-EOT - &csconfig.PluginCfg{ - User: "nobody", - Group: "nogroup", + &csconfig.PrometheusCfg{ + Enabled: true, + Level: "full", + ListenAddr: "127.0.0.1", + ListenPort: 6060, } EOT } + @test "cscli - required configuration paths" { config=$(cat "${CONFIG_YAML}") configdir=$(config_get '.config_paths.config_dir') diff --git a/test/bats/04_capi.bats b/test/bats/04_capi.bats index 64da27a56..d5154c1a0 100644 --- a/test/bats/04_capi.bats +++ b/test/bats/04_capi.bats @@ -43,7 +43,7 @@ setup() { config_set 'del(.api.server.online_client)' rune -1 cscli capi status - assert_stderr --partial "no configuration for Central API (CAPI) in '$CONFIG_YAML'" + assert_stderr --regexp "no configuration for Central API \(CAPI\) in '$(echo $CONFIG_YAML|sed s#//#/#g)'" } @test "cscli capi status" {